LaMelo Ball, Tyrese Haliburton, And More Star In New PUMA Hoops Ad

It’s been a good few weeks for PUMA Hoops. Their biggest headlines, signing Tyrese Haliburton and recruiting Salehe Bembury as creative director of their basketball sub-brand, collided with some select social content in the days after. Now, PUMA is bringing together all their most notable signees for their widest spot yet.

Taking the viewer through a whirlwind of park venues, each of the German giant’s signature hoopers make an appearance, beginning with their longest-tenured, LaMelo Ball. After dapping up an alien to reference his “NOT FROM HERE” motto, LSU’s Flau’jae Johnson, projected to be a top pick in the 2026 WNBA Draft, pulls up, having a brief back-and-forth with a literal Puma mascot. The animalistic/cartoonish theme continues with Scoot Henderson and Chester the Cheetah (see their collab on the Scoot Zero), as well as Breonna Stewart and a pack of GOATs. Finally, the newest face closes things out, delivering the newly minted PUMA Hoops motto: “See the game like we do.”

While the foremost purpose is ostensibly increasing the brand’s public recognizability, there will, of course, be a run-off effect for the actual footwear worn in this spot. The Stewie 3, MB.04, Scoot Zero and Haliburton’s choice for 2024-25, the PUMA Nitro Elite, all get their moment in the spotlight.
